So a headline on the Worldwide Leader's homepage got me to thinking. The headline is, "Bulldogs Face SEC Royalty" - the "Royalty" moniker referring to Bammer. Clearly and objectively, we would have to rank them Number 1 on the "Royalty Meter" in the SEC when it comes to college football history, tradition and accomplishments, regardless of how many of their so-called "NCs" are BS. And clearly, Vandy or maybe UK would rank 14. The question is, where would you rank us?

This "Royalty" criteria is football tradition, history, championships/accomplishments, etc., and to include some of the newer conference additions, these football criteria are not exclusive to the SEC (A&M's SWC and Big 12 records would apply). Other qualities, such as academic rankings do not apply.

So what say you? Where would we rank on a football SEC "Royalty" Ranking?
